A required firm liquidation (or obligatory winding up) is instituted by an order made by the court, typically on the petition of a financial institution, the firm or a shareholder. There are a number of feasible reasons for making a winding-up order. The most usual is since the company is bankrupt.



In an obligatory liquidation the function of a liquidator is in the majority of situations originally carried out by an authorities called the. The Official Receiver is a policeman of the court and a participant of the Insolvency Service, an exec agency within the In most obligatory liquidations, the Authorities Receiver ends up being the liquidator quickly on the making of the winding-up order.

Your limited business may be sold off (ended up) if it can not pay individuals or organisations it owes cash to (its creditors). This is a general guide only. You must additionally obtain specialist advice from a solicitor, your accountant or an insolvency expert. When your firm owes cash the creditors may try to recover the debt by providing an official request for payment, called a statutory demand.

This usually means closing the company and placing residential or commercial property and possessions under the control of a provisional liquidator designated by the court. The court issues a winding-up order if it decides your firm can not pay its financial debts and is bankrupt. A liquidator will certainly be designated. They will take control of the firm and its properties.

Business liquidation is the procedure of shutting down a minimal company with the help of a selected Bankruptcy Manager - Company Liquidation, also called a liquidator. The liquidator is brought into the company to 'wind up' all continuous events up until, at the end of the procedure, the firm is brought to a close.

Much more usually than not, HMRC will be the primary financial institution because of unsettled tax obligations such as Corporation Tax Obligation, VAT, Pay As You Gain (PAYE) or National Insurance Contributions (NIC). Trade financial institutions, such as suppliers, will additionally have the ability to do something about it if they think they are unlikely to be paid what they are owed.
